Readability and Visual Hierarchy
One of the key considerations when using Potlar is readability. While it works beautifully for headlines and short text, it may not be the best choice for longer paragraphs or body copy. For these, I paired Potlar with a clean, simple sans serif font, ensuring that the content remains easy to read and the visual hierarchy is clear.
- Hero Titles: Use Potlar for impactful and memorable headlines.
- Section Headings: Apply Potlar to add a creative touch to your section titles.
- Buttons and CTAs: Incorporate Potlar for short, attention-grabing calls to action.
- Logo Text: Utilize Potlar for a distinctive and personalized logo.
- Decorative Accents: Add Potlar for small, decorative text elements to enhance visual interest.

Practical Considerations for Using Potlar
Before incorporating Potlar into your web design projects, it's important to check a few practical aspects. First, ensure that the font includes the necessary styles and weights for your specific needs. Additionally, verify that the font is available as a webfont and supports the languages you need. Lastly, confirm that the commercial font licensing allows for use in your intended projects, whether they are client work, online stores, or digital templates.
